Commit graph

757 commits

Author SHA1 Message Date
Paulus Schoutsen
7e3de4d6f7 Don't include device specific code in coverage 2015-03-07 07:49:19 -08:00
Theodor Lindquist
7880b6a11d Merge pull request #47 from theolind/dev
Added a system monitoring platform to the sensor component
2015-03-07 15:58:04 +01:00
theolind
1215b5e994 Fixed type issue 2015-03-07 15:55:32 +01:00
theolind
828c78cb1f fixed style errors 2015-03-07 15:49:58 +01:00
theolind
b42b680ef5 Merge remote-tracking branch 'upstream/dev' into dev
Conflicts:
	requirements.txt
2015-03-07 15:34:47 +01:00
theolind
d7a4242c74 Specified the component that uses psutil (sensor.systemmonitor) 2015-03-07 15:31:09 +01:00
theolind
dd92173576 Made example config more YAMLy 2015-03-07 15:27:31 +01:00
theolind
3173249dc3 fixed typo 2015-03-07 15:24:35 +01:00
theolind
97258747c7 Renamed device to resource 2015-03-07 15:22:03 +01:00
theolind
19964e914a Added a system monitoring platform to the sensor component 2015-03-07 14:54:08 +01:00
Paulus Schoutsen
d3e107a882 Clean up requirements.txt 2015-03-07 05:49:22 -08:00
Paulus Schoutsen
fde0ce1997 Remove CONF_TYPE and platform_devices_from_config 2015-03-06 00:04:32 -08:00
Paulus Schoutsen
3e15742875 Move device ABCs to separate helper file 2015-03-05 23:18:22 -08:00
Paulus Schoutsen
68668fc658 Light/Switch/Thermostat: use new extract_from_service helper 2015-03-05 23:17:05 -08:00
Paulus Schoutsen
72b930af8f Fix: Hue reports state correctly if 2 services called quickly 2015-03-05 22:53:11 -08:00
Paulus Schoutsen
1b4ff986b0 Add remember login option 2015-03-05 21:37:44 -08:00
Paulus Schoutsen
4e6773969a Fix: Login form shows error message again 2015-03-05 20:43:40 -08:00
Paulus Schoutsen
ba9f29a04b Fix http/zwave being too strict on the config 2015-03-05 20:43:20 -08:00
Paulus Schoutsen
b04d6f94e6 Merge pull request #45 from balloob/tellstick-sensor-refactor
Refactor Tellstick sensors to be a sensor platform
2015-03-05 08:44:00 -08:00
Paulus Schoutsen
a09c5d88db Update favicon.ico 2015-03-05 00:19:13 -08:00
Paulus Schoutsen
be9d6b9422 Remove forced orientation from manifest.json 2015-03-04 09:23:14 -08:00
Paulus Schoutsen
84844c242b Refactor chromecast into media_player platform 2015-03-03 23:50:54 -08:00
Paulus Schoutsen
fc3375508e Frontend: Remove tellstick_sensor domain icon 2015-03-03 22:20:48 -08:00
Paulus Schoutsen
663735542b Refactor tellstick_sensor to a sensor platform 2015-03-03 22:19:29 -08:00
Paulus Schoutsen
a90dcabe01 Higher quality favicon.ico 2015-03-03 21:49:20 -08:00
Paulus Schoutsen
fa9f5073f6 Update logo 2015-03-03 21:15:21 -08:00
Paulus Schoutsen
9616a2292e Add manifest.json 2015-03-03 21:15:15 -08:00
Paulus Schoutsen
b4f743bda3 ZWave component now reports init success 2015-03-03 08:49:31 -08:00
Paulus Schoutsen
2727fd12ee Merge pull request #42 from balloob/chore-refactor-device-components
Refactor device components
2015-03-01 11:12:03 -08:00
Paulus Schoutsen
00047009e2 Only poll for device updates if necessary 2015-03-01 11:04:07 -08:00
Paulus Schoutsen
0fd89a4b1f Fix a WeMo discovery issue 2015-03-01 10:43:08 -08:00
Paulus Schoutsen
7938cbffd4 Suppress specific import errors in the loader 2015-03-01 10:40:07 -08:00
Paulus Schoutsen
5fe50066a6 Make device component backwards compatible 2015-03-01 10:28:53 -08:00
Paulus Schoutsen
3b7b34b3df Fix Style 2015-03-01 01:39:28 -08:00
Paulus Schoutsen
508a433a92 Fix Style 2015-03-01 01:39:12 -08:00
Paulus Schoutsen
fce3e239a7 Update import from netdisco 2015-03-01 01:36:19 -08:00
Paulus Schoutsen
89100d14c8 Refactored device components 2015-03-01 01:35:58 -08:00
Paulus Schoutsen
f0c6ac1aa3 Update import from netdisco 2015-03-01 01:34:49 -08:00
Paulus Schoutsen
63bf1373b7 Disable pylint import error check 2015-02-28 23:02:26 -08:00
Paulus Schoutsen
19d243d159 ZWave Sensor values push changes to HA 2015-02-28 22:49:55 -08:00
Paulus Schoutsen
67161d686b Use PyDispatcher instead of Louie 2015-02-28 22:49:27 -08:00
Paulus Schoutsen
8bd803601f Devices can now be polling or push 2015-02-28 22:33:44 -08:00
Paulus Schoutsen
8567dd001b Merge remote-tracking branch 'origin/feature-openzwave' into feature-openzwave
* origin/feature-openzwave:
  Update zwave related scripts
  Z-Wave sensors should work now
  Register to Z-Wave sensor updates
  Get Z-Wave sensors to work with Home Assistant
  Minor documentation updates
  Working zwave!
  Get python-openzwave working in Docker

Conflicts:
	scripts/build_python_openzwave
2015-02-28 21:08:24 -08:00
Paulus Schoutsen
7636769c11 Update discovery to work without zeroconf installed 2015-02-28 21:06:59 -08:00
Paulus Schoutsen
7c2d92c55d Update zwave related scripts 2015-02-28 20:27:42 -08:00
Paulus Schoutsen
fa76cb8f8c Z-Wave sensors should work now 2015-02-28 20:27:42 -08:00
Paulus Schoutsen
1b00515899 Register to Z-Wave sensor updates 2015-02-28 20:27:42 -08:00
Paulus Schoutsen
e7b9b86c64 Get Z-Wave sensors to work with Home Assistant 2015-02-28 20:27:42 -08:00
Paulus Schoutsen
85f7f5589d Minor documentation updates 2015-02-28 20:27:42 -08:00
Paulus Schoutsen
9c61c281ca Working zwave!
Open docker, go to /usr/src/balloob-python-openzwave/examples, run
python3 api_demo.py --device=/zwaveusbstick --log=Debug
2015-02-28 20:27:42 -08:00